Ask Yourself (and Your Team) These 3 Sustainability Checks:
Would this still work if I took a week off?
Are we building repeatable processes—or reinventing the wheel each time?
Do our wins depend on overworking the same people?
If the answer is “no” or “not sure”—you’ve got an opportunity to strengthen your foundation.
